"Private" shoutcast streams

I'd rather run a shoutcast stream with only limited access allowed for vetted sources.

Can shoutcast support "private" streaming?

I've RTFM can don't see anything about it.

See Tom's reply in this post.

Summary:
Make your stream non-public
Run in RIP mode
Add RIPs

FYI:
RIP = Reserved IP
